Field note · Minnesota stocks by year, not by truck day: walleye fry go in within weeks of ice-out, fingerlings and yearlings mostly in fall, and stream trout in spring and fall. A row here means the fish went in during that year; DNR adds the year's rows after the fact, so the current year can look empty until winter.

Catch per net (CPUE) is the DNR survey's count per gill net or trap net set; higher means more of that species were sampled, not a fishing forecast. Top species per gear shown; where we have no verified common name for a DNR code, the code itself is shown.

Mills Lake is located southeast of Lake Crystal and off highway 169. This small (230 acre) lake has a maximum depth of 7 feet. Mills Lake has a good population of 7 - 8.5 inch black crappie and low abundance of northern pike, yellow perch, bluegill and largemouth bass. There is a good population of 8.5 - 10 inch black bullhead that average a half pound.
